Understanding Return to Player (RTP)
It is most commonly used in reference to slot machines and represents the percentage of all the wagered money that a slot will pay back to players over time. When choosing a slot game, looking for one with a high RTP (generally 96% or above) can give you a better chance of a winning session. The remaining 4% is the house edge.

Personalized Gaming: The casino's interface could dynamically change to show you the games you're most likely to enjoy, or it could offer you bonuses and promotions that are tailored specifically to your preferences, rather than generic offers. Advanced Responsible Gambling: By analyzing gameplay data in real-time, AI can identify patterns of behavior that may indicate problem gambling (such as chasing losses or a sudden, drastic increase in play time) and proactively intervene by offering cooling-off periods or directing the player to support resources. Enhanced Customer Service: Sophisticated AI-powered chatbots will be able to handle complex customer queries instantly, 24/7, providing a level of service that is faster and more efficient than human agents for routine issues.
